Executive understands that nothing in this Full and Final Release of Claims or any previous confidentiality agreement prohibits Executive from reporting possible violations of federal law or regulation to any governmental agency or entity, including but not limited to the Securities and Exchange Commission, or making other disclosures that are protected under the whistleblower protections of federal law or regulation, including the Defend Trade Secrets Act of 2016 (“DTSA”). Executive understands that, under the DTSA, Executive may not be held criminally or civilly liable under federal or state trade secrets laws for the disclosure of trade secrets if the disclosure is made: (i) in confidence to a federal, state, or local government official, either directly or indirectly, or to an attorney, for the sole purpose of reporting or investigating a suspected violation of law, or (ii) in a complaint or other document filed in a lawsuit or similar proceeding, provided the filing is made under seal.

To the extent Executive worked or resides in California, to effect a full and complete general release as described above, Executive hereby waives and relinquishes all rights and benefits afforded by Section 1542 of the California Civil Code and does so understanding and acknowledging the significance and consequence of specifically waiving section 1542. Section 1542 of the California Civil Code reads as follows:

A GENERAL RELEASE DOES NOT EXTEND TO CLAIMS WHICH THE CREDITOR OR RELEASING PARTY DOES NOT KNOW OR SUSPECT TO EXIST IN HIS OR HER FAVOR AT THE TIME OF EXECUTING THE RELEASE AND THAT, IF KNOWN BY HIM OR HER, WOULD HAVE MATERIALLY AFFECTED HIS OR HER SETTLEMENT WITH THE DEBTOR OR RELEASED PARTY.

Thus, notwithstanding the provisions of section 1542, and to implement a full and complete release and discharge of the Constellation Released Parties, Executive expressly acknowledges this Full and Final Release of Claims is intended to include in its effect, without limitation, all claims Executive does not know or suspect to exist in Executive’s favor at the time of signing this Full and Final Release of Claims, and that this Full and Final Release of Claims
